WINEMAKER'S NOTES:
The 2016 Dante Chardonnay is a lovely golden color in the glass, with explosive aromas of juicy Asian pear, honey suckle, and mandarin oranges, with a hint of crème brûlée. The mouth is round and creamy, with layers of enticing flavors: lemon curd, Tahitian vanilla, and sweet orange. The wine is framed by a well balanced acidity, and the lengthy finish is smooth with light caramel.
